Sightron Digital Contents Metroid Prime & Fusion Original Soundtracks CD GAME
Manufacturer : Sightron Digital Contents
EAN : 4949168102705
Run time : 2 hours and 11 minutes
Label : Sightron Digital Contents
Country of Origin : Japan
Number of discs : 1
Japanese Import
Metroid Prime & Fusion Original Soundtracks CD
Dive into the legendary Metroid universe with this must-have original soundtrack. Published by Sightron Digital Contents, this collection features the iconic music from Metroid Prime and Metroid Fusion. These two classic games, celebrated for their immersive atmospheres, come to life through orchestral, electronic, and cinematic compositions.
- Metroid Prime: Experience dark, mysterious tracks that capture the essence of exploring Tallon IV.
- Metroid Fusion: Feel the energy and tension of tracks that follow Samus through the biological threats aboard the B.S.L. space station.
A must-have for fans of the series and video game music enthusiasts, perfect for reliving these legendary adventures or enriching your collection. A unique auditory journey into the world of Metroid!
